AFFORDABLE EVENT PROFESSIONALS AT YOUR EVENT SOURCE CHARLOTTE NEAR YOU.

Affordable Event Professionals at Your Event Source Charlotte Near You.

Affordable Event Professionals at Your Event Source Charlotte Near You.

Blog Article

The Future of Occasion Sourcing: How It Boosts System Performance and Scalability



As organizations significantly adopt event-driven styles, the future of event sourcing stands to improve how systems carry out and scale. This paradigm not just allows effective handling of big information quantities however likewise advertises asynchronous interaction and decoupled components, which are essential for boosting responsiveness. Additionally, the immutability of occasions offers distinct possibilities for optimizing information access and lowering latency. The ramifications of these advancements elevate essential questions about their long-lasting influence on system layout and functional complexity. What obstacles and chances lie ahead in totally using this strategy?




Recognizing Occasion Sourcing



Occasion sourcing, a standard that has acquired substantial traction in modern software application design, describes the practice of catching all adjustments to an application's state as a series of events. This technique contrasts with typical approaches where state adjustments are commonly saved as current worths in a database. Instead, occasion sourcing stresses the relevance of the background of state changes, allowing systems to rebuild the current state by replaying events.


Each event stands for an unique change and is immutable, making sure that the system can maintain a trustworthy audit trail. This immutability not only boosts data integrity but also assists in temporal inquiries, making it possible for designers to assess historic states and shifts. Events can be enhanced with metadata, offering context concerning just how and why a state change happened.


Occasion sourcing inherently supports the principles of domain-driven style by straightening the model closely with business processes. This approach promotes a far better understanding of the domain name while enabling a more responsive system architecture (your event source charlotte). As applications advance, event sourcing supplies a robust framework for handling intricate state shifts and boosts general system strength, leading the way for a lot more innovative and adaptable software application remedies


Benefits of Occasion Sourcing



Among the main advantages of taking on occasion sourcing is its ability to provide an extensive audit route of changes within an application. This audit route documents every state change as an immutable sequence of occasions, permitting designers to trace the history of adjustments effortlessly. Debugging and understanding system actions comes to be extra manageable, as each event can be replayed to reconstruct previous states.


In addition, event sourcing fosters enhanced data integrity. Because every change is captured as an event, the threat of data loss is minimized, and systems can be recovered to any factor in time. This feature verifies indispensable in situations where information consistency is critical.


Furthermore, occasion sourcing advertises decoupling of components within a system. By relying upon events for communication, various solutions can progress independently, boosting flexibility and maintainability. This architectural design supports scalability, enabling organizations to deal with raised lots a lot more efficiently.




Finally, event sourcing assistances complex business processes and operations by enabling event-driven designs to grow. This capability to model intricate communications provides a solid foundation for developing durable and responsive systems that adapt to transforming service requirements.


Enhancing System Performance



Efficient system performance is essential for any kind of application, and embracing event sourcing can significantly improve this facet. By leveraging a version that captures all changes as a series of events, occasion sourcing permits enhanced performance in different means. It allows reliable information access, as the current state can be reconstructed from a series of events without the need for complex joins or inquires throughout numerous tables. This streamlined gain access to causes lowered latency and faster response times.


your event source charlotteyour event source charlotte
In addition, occasion sourcing cultivates an extra natural separation of worries within the application architecture. By isolating the create and review versions, systems can be fine-tuned for performance. While the occasion store deals with the determination of events, the read versions can be enhanced independently, allowing for tailored information access patterns that boost overall performance.


Additionally, the immutability of events in occasion sourcing means that systems can take advantage of caching better. When an event is tape-recorded, it can be securely cached, minimizing the need for duplicated data source calls. This not only boosts efficiency however additionally increases the system's durability against information corruption. Therefore, event sourcing stands out as a powerful approach to enhancing system performance in modern-day applications.


Scalability in Event-Driven Architectures



Scaling applications properly often depends upon taking on event-driven styles, which naturally sustain the dynamic nature of modern systems. By decoupling parts and utilizing asynchronous communication, these architectures facilitate the independent scaling of solutions based upon need. This adaptability enables organizations to assign sources much more effectively, resulting in improved responsiveness and lowered latency.


In event-driven systems, events act as triggers that launch processes throughout dispersed components, enabling straight scalability. your event source charlotte. As workloads raise, additional instances of services can be deployed without disrupting existing performance. In addition, making use of event queues helps handle spikes in web traffic, permitting smooth assimilation of brand-new solutions or components as required.


your event source charlotteyour event source charlotte
Furthermore, occasion sourcing complements scalability by supplying a reliable device for rebuilding system useful reference states via a log of events. This not just boosts fault tolerance however also supports data uniformity across dispersed services, which is vital in a scalable design.


Future Trends in Occasion Sourcing



your event source charlotteyour event source charlotte
Accepting event sourcing as a fundamental building pattern is positioned to form the future of system layout and data monitoring significantly. As organizations progressively look for to leverage real-time data for decision-making, event sourcing deals a durable option by catching state modifications as a series of events. This trend is prepared for to improve system performance via boosted data retrieval and processing abilities.




One noteworthy future pattern is the combination of occasion sourcing with man-made intelligence and artificial intelligence. By evaluating historic event information, companies can acquire workable insights, bring about automated decision-making processes. In addition, the increase of cloud-native styles will promote the usage a fantastic read of event sourcing, making it possible for scalable and resilient systems that can efficiently take care of rising and fall workloads.


Furthermore, the adoption of microservices will remain to drive the development of event sourcing. This building technique enables groups to establish and release solutions independently, cultivating agility and minimizing time-to-market (your event source charlotte). As companies prioritize data integrity and auditability, occasion sourcing will certainly solidify its function in compliance and governing structures


Verdict



The future of occasion sourcing holds promise for considerable improvements in system performance and scalability. The immutability of occasions not only sustains efficient caching and fast data retrieval great post to read however likewise contributes to reduce latency.

Report this page